13a Ashlar Rd, Moorabbin is a 3 bedroom, 2 bathroom Unit with 2 parking spaces and was built in 1995. The property has a land size of 232m2 and floor size of 125m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in October 2014.

The size of Moorabbin is approximately 4.6 square kilometres. It has 5 parks covering nearly 4.2% of total area. The population of Moorabbin in 2016 was 5895 people. By 2021 the population was 6287 showing a population growth of 6.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Moorabbin is 30-39 years. Households in Moorabbin are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$3000 - $3999 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Moorabbin work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 68.00% of the homes in Moorabbin were owner-occupied compared with 68.80% in 2016.
Moorabbin has 5,616 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Moorabbin have seen a 26.46%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 23.75% increase. As at 30 November 2025:
